Returned oyer and terminer commission, Middlesex, before Thomas earl of Derby, Thomas Ormond of Rochford, kt, Robert Willoughby of Broke, kt, William Huse, kt, Thomas Bryan, kt, William Hody, kt, John Fyneux, Reynold Bray, kt, and Richard Guldeford, kt, at Westminster on 20-25 Feb and 12 July 1494, under commission of 16 Feb 1494 (CPR 1485-94, 477), for all treasons, murders, insurrections, rebellions, felonies, misprisions, escapes of felons, contempts, offences, rapes of women, impetitions, trespasses, congregations, riots and alleged conventicles in Middlesex: trial of John Burton, Robert Bulkeley, Edward Dyves and others for plotting the king's death and the destruction and subversion of his realm, complicity in Perkin Warbeck's rebellion: file of commission, indictments, panels, etc, mm 4-24; enrolment, mm 2-3; cover, m 1.
Number of membranes: 24.
